The Importance of RSVPing

When it comes to attending a wedding, responding to the invitation is not only a courteous gesture, but it is also crucial for the couple planning their big day. Providing an accurate headcount allows them to make necessary arrangements, finalize seating plans, and ensure that every guest feels welcomed and included.

Responding in a Timely Manner

One of the most important aspects of wedding RSVP etiquette is responding promptly. Couples typically set a specific deadline to receive responses, and it is essential to adhere to this timeline. Aim to send in your RSVP as soon as possible to avoid any inconveniences and help the couple plan their event more efficiently.

RSVP Options

Wedding invitations often provide various response options, such as traditional mail, email, or online platforms. It is crucial to follow the preferred method indicated by the couple. If they have provided an online RSVP option, take advantage of this convenient method, as it simplifies the process for both you and the couple.

Plus One Predicament

When it comes to bringing a guest or a «+1,» it is essential to follow the instructions on the invitation. If the invitation does not explicitly mention a plus one or does not include «and guest,» it is best to assume that the invitation is intended for you alone. This helps the couple manage their guest list more effectively and ensures that they can accommodate everyone comfortably.

Declining an Invitation

If you are unable to attend the wedding, it is crucial to let the couple know as soon as possible. Express your regrets in a polite and sincere manner, thanking them for the invitation and explaining your reasons for not being able to attend. This gesture shows thoughtfulness and consideration for the couple’s planning efforts.

Attending as a Group

If you are part of a family or group of friends who received a joint invitation, be sure to indicate the exact number of attendees. This helps the couple accurately plan for the number of seats needed and any other arrangements.

Special Requests or Dietary Restrictions

If you have any special requests or dietary restrictions, it is considerate to inform the couple when RSVPing. Whether it is a food allergy, vegetarian preference, or any other specific requirement, notifying the couple allows them to make the necessary arrangements and ensure everyone feels included and catered to.

Setting a Reasonable RSVP Deadline

When sending out your wedding invitations, it’s crucial to include an RSVP deadline. This deadline gives your guests a clear indication of when their response is expected. Typically, a reasonable timeframe for guests to RSVP is around four to six weeks before the wedding date. This gives them ample time to check their schedules, make travel arrangements if necessary, and let you know if they will be able to attend your special day.

Why is the RSVP Deadline Important?

Planning a wedding involves numerous details, such as finalizing the guest count, seating arrangements, and catering. Knowing the number of guests attending is essential for ensuring that everything runs smoothly. By providing a specific RSVP deadline, you give yourself enough time to make any necessary adjustments and communicate with your vendors accurately.

Considerations for Destination Weddings or Holiday Seasons

In certain circumstances, such as destination weddings or holiday seasons, it’s advisable to extend the RSVP deadline. Destination weddings often require guests to make travel arrangements, including booking flights and accommodations. Giving them extra time to plan and make arrangements shows consideration for their needs.

Similarly, if your wedding falls during a busy holiday season, it’s wise to provide guests with more time to respond. People’s schedules tend to be packed during these periods, and allowing for additional time ensures that they can prioritize your wedding and give you a prompt response.

Handling Late RSVPs

Despite your best efforts, there will always be some guests who fail to RSVP by the provided deadline. As a courteous host, it’s important to handle these late responses graciously. Reach out to these guests individually and inquire about their attendance. Be understanding and flexible, as unforeseen circumstances may have caused the delay in their response.

Follow Up: The Gentle Reminder

For those guests who have not responded by the deadline, it’s acceptable to send a gentle reminder. This serves as a friendly nudge to ensure that they haven’t overlooked your invitation. You can send a polite email or make a quick phone call to inquire about their attendance. Remember to be understanding and avoid putting unnecessary pressure on your guests.

The Basics of RSVP Cards

Before we dive into the proper recipient for wedding RSVP cards, let’s first understand their purpose. RSVP cards, short for «Répondez s’il vous plaît,» are an essential part of any wedding invitation. They serve as a formal request for guests to respond and confirm their attendance or regrets for the big day.

Traditionally, RSVP cards include a pre-addressed and stamped envelope, making it easy for guests to reply. However, the question remains: who should be the recipient of these cards?

The Correct Recipient

1. The Hosts

In most cases, the RSVP cards should be addressed to the hosts of the wedding. This is typically the couple or their parents, depending on who is officially hosting the event. If the invitation specifies the names of the hosts, the RSVP cards should be addressed to them.

2. The Wedding Planner

If the couple has hired a wedding planner to handle all the logistics and details of the event, the RSVP cards can be addressed to them. This is especially common for larger weddings or when the couple prefers to have a professional manage the RSVP process.

3. The Couple Themselves

In some cases, couples opt to have the RSVP cards addressed to themselves. This may be because they are handling the guest list personally or want to have a clear idea of who will attend. If the invitation does not specify another recipient, addressing the RSVP cards to the couple is a safe choice.

Addressing the RSVP Cards

Now that you know who the proper recipient should be, let’s discuss how to address the RSVP cards. Here are a few key points to keep in mind:

1. Use Formal Titles

When addressing the RSVP cards, use formal titles such as «Mr.,» «Mrs.,» or «Ms.» followed by the recipient’s full name. This adds a touch of elegance and respect to the invitation.

2. Double-Check Spellings

Ensure that you have correctly spelled the names of the recipients. Mistakes in spelling can be seen as careless and may cause unnecessary confusion.

3. Provide Ample Space for Responses

Include enough space on the RSVP cards for guests to write their response. This can be in the form of checkboxes for attending or declining, or by leaving space for a written response.

4. Encourage Prompt Responses

Lastly, consider including a polite request for guests to respond promptly. This will help you plan the wedding more efficiently and ensure that no important details are overlooked.
